Muktsar offers a unique dining experience with its local cuisine and delicious dishes. From traditional Punjabi dishes to fusion creations, you can explore a variety of flavours. Indulge in the rich and spicy flavours of sarson da saag and makki di roti, or savor the succulent tandoori dishes like chicken tikka and seekh kebab. Don't miss out on the famous Amritsari kulcha and lassi, a perfect combination of stuffed bread and refreshing yogurt drink. The local street food scene is also a must-try, offering mouthwatering chaat, samosas, and pakoras.

Muktsar boasts a year-around average temperature of 24.6°C, peaking at 33.9°C in June,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of 13.7°C in January,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 56.3mm annually, with July seeing the heaviest showers and November being the driest month.

Monthcalendar iconTemperature (Celcius)temperature iconRainfall (mm)rain icon
January13.734.3
February16.153.3
March20.769.8
April27.161.0
May31.569.8
June33.988.9
July31.5105.4
August30.8101.6
September29.745.7
October25.620.3
November19.88.1
December15.117.8

What's the best way to get around Muktsar?

If you want to see more of the area, take a train from Faqarsar Station, Malout Station or Giddarbaha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Muktsar for your journey.

The Muktsar info point: What you need to know

Category
Details
LocationMuktsar, Punjab, India
LanguagePunjabi, Hindi, English
Best Time to VisitOctober to March
WeatherHot summers, cool winters
Must-Visit AttractionsGurudwara Sahib Muktsar, Lakh Daata Peer, Darbar Sahib
Local CuisineSarson da Saag, Makki di Roti, Butter Chicken
TransportationTaxis, Auto-rickshaws, Buses
Local FestivalsMaghi Mela, Hola Mohalla
